I am working with a Formula column on my Structure board. In this Formula, I want to convert timeSpent into a number value, in weeks. Ultimately, the purpose is to then divide that value by another number that is already in weeks, then display the final Formula column as a Percentage.
I am struggling to get timeSpent converted to weeks correctly within my Formula.
Using Google time converter, 1669200000 milliseconds does not convert ~11 weeks.
However.. 1669200000 milliseconds does convert to ~2.7 weeks...
Any ideas on what formula Structure is using to get 1669200000 into ~11 weeks, similar to Duration "Work Time" ON, so that I can replicate it within my Formula column??
Here are some screenshots demonstrating...
I think I was able to convert my total milliseconds into workweeks by dividing it by the number of milliseconds in 40 hours. :)
It seems like the ~2.7 number is total time, whereas "Work Time" uses your Jira work settings. So I need a formula to convert total time into Jira weeks. (My settings are 5 days in a week, 8 hours in a day.)
